Gigabyte Has New GSmart Handsets

Gigabyte has rolled out two new handsets from the GSmart range – the MW702 and MS802. Both PDA phones will be available in Hungary, sharing the same specifications although the former maxes out at EDGE while the latter supports HSDPA connectivity. Other than that, the specifications are as follows :-

  • Marvell PXA270 520MHz processor
  • Windows Mobile 6.1 Professional operating system
  • 2.8″ 65k color TFT LCD at 240 x 320 resolution
  • 256MB ROM
  • 128MB RAM
  • GPS navigation
  • 3 megapixel camera with autofocus
  • Wi-Fi and Bluetooth 2.0 connectivity
  • Mini USB 2.0 port
  • microSD memory card slot

No idea on how much these puppies will cost, but it looks like a pretty sweet handset. The user interface also looks customized compared to the standard Windows Mobile 6.1 interface.
